kenvandine | hello desktoppers | 13:50 |
oSoMoN | hey kenvandine! | 13:50 |
kenvandine | i'm building a xenial backport of gnome 3.24 in a ppa for the platform snap | 13:50 |
kenvandine | but running into a gtk test failure only on xenial | 13:50 |
kenvandine | ERROR:/build/gtk+3.0-dBZtvN/gtk+3.0-3.22.15/./testsuite/css/style/test-css-style.c:115:load_ui_file: assertion failed (error == NULL): colornames.css:120:42'rebeccapurple' is not a valid color name (gtk-css-provider-error-quark, 1) | 13:51 |
kenvandine | which i think is related to this | 13:51 |
kenvandine | Failed to open file “./test-css-style.gresource.xml”: No such file or directory | 13:51 |
kenvandine | anyone familiar with those gresource files that can confirm that might be the cause? | 13:51 |
kenvandine | full build log at https://launchpadlibrarian.net/320395481/buildlog_ubuntu-xenial-amd64.gtk+3.0_3.22.15-0ubuntu1_BUILDING.txt.gz | 13:52 |
seb128 | kenvandine, the zesty build has the same no such file so it's not likely the issue | 14:00 |
kenvandine | seb128, ah... ok | 14:01 |
* kenvandine should have thought to check for the warning :) | 14:01 | |
seb128 | I wonder if it uses external files as a reference | 14:01 |
kenvandine | oh... | 14:01 |
seb128 | kenvandine, try maybe reverting https://git.gnome.org/browse/gtk+/commit/testsuite/css/style/colornames.ui?id=c27b8b48 ? | 14:02 |
kenvandine | rebeccapurple is defined in the test | 14:02 |
seb128 | just to see | 14:02 |
Laney | I think those come from pango | 14:02 |
Laney | try building that first | 14:02 |
seb128 | https://git.gnome.org/browse/gtk+/commit/?id=c27b8b48 | 14:02 |
seb128 | in fact | 14:02 |
seb128 | k, Laney got there first :p | 14:02 |
seb128 | I was looking at what provides the reference | 14:02 |
kenvandine | oh... | 14:02 |
Laney | sry :-) | 14:02 |
kenvandine | damn ordering issue :) | 14:02 |
kenvandine | ok, thanks! | 14:02 |
seb128 | I told you that deps might be needed | 14:03 |
seb128 | :p | 14:03 |
kenvandine | seb128, indeed... | 14:03 |
Laney | if that's true, please commit a BD version bump | 14:03 |
kenvandine | sure | 14:03 |
kenvandine | i'll push that to the ~ubuntu-desktop branch as well so it makes it in the next uplaod | 14:03 |
kenvandine | upload | 14:03 |
Laney | ya | 14:03 |
seb128 | but yeah | 14:03 |
seb128 | https://git.gnome.org/browse/pango/commit/?id=5aa230b1421b1a7dff8525125a5a22de48c5b6e9 | 14:03 |
kenvandine | thanks guys | 14:03 |
seb128 | confirmed in https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=770653 | 14:04 |
ubot5 | Gnome bug 770653 in .General "test-suite failure: testsuite/css/style/test-css-style.c: FAIL" [Normal,Resolved: wontfix] | 14:04 |
seb128 | "don't see a strong reason to bump the pango dependency, just to make a test pass." | 14:04 |
